Indium Corporation’s AuLTRA™ 75 is an off-eutectic AuSn preform solution (75Au/25Sn) designed to improve intermetallic reliability in applications using a die with a thicker gold plating, such as a GaN die used for high-frequency, high-power RF power amplifier devices for 5G and other critical military and aerospace wireless communications. AuLTRA™ 75 helps improve the operation of these critical technologies by adjusting the final solder joint composition and improving wetting and voiding. The AuLTRA™ product line also comes in 78Au/22Sn and 79Au/21Sn compositions.
Indium Corporation’s AuLTRA™ ThInFORMS™ are 0.00035"-thick (0.00889mm or 8.89μm) 80Au/20Sn preforms that improve the overall operational efficiency of high-output lasers. AuLTRA™ ThInFORMS™ help combat common issues such as:
- Shorting—reduced solder volume inhibits wicking up the die, minimizing the risk of shorting
- Poor thermal transfer—the ultra-thin 0.00035" preform reduces bondline thickness (BLT), thus improving thermal transfer and increasing the longevity and performance of the device.

The most commonly used gold-based alloy is 80Au/20Sn; it is the pillar alloy of the microelectronics industry with a melting point of 280°C and works exceptionally well in the majority of die-attach and lid sealing applications. It exhibits good thermal fatigue properties and is used in many applications that require high tensile strength and high corrosive resistance. Additionally, Heat-Spring® is a compressible, non-reflow metal TIM ideal for TIM2 applications. These indium-containing TIMs offer superior thermal conductivity over non-metals—with pure indium metal delivering 86W/mK in all planes. Because of its sold metal state, Heat-Spring avoids pump-out and bake-out problems. It also offers a sustainable solution due to our indium reclaim and recycle program.
